    Many thanks for your good plugin. I would like to inform you that I have three major issues with your plugin at the moment.
    First, In the main search bar that appears in the homepage, the drop-down button does not appear, so the user can’t choose any filters or taxonomies.
    Second, the filters on the widgets areas are not working. No matter what taxonomy is used, the same results are shown.
    Third, with some certain keyboard that exists in some articles and courses, the site keeps spinning and no results are shown. For example, the word “read”.

    Hi Louay,

    Thank you for the proper details, it helps me a lot!

    1. Make sure that the swith is enabled, otherwise it will not be displayed, you can enable it here: https://i.imgur.com/RgYBtJC.png

    2. I assume, that results, that does not belong to any of the filtered taxonomies are displayed. This is the default behaviour, but in some cases this is not the expected behaviour. To turn off results, that does not belong to any of the category filters, you can turn off this option. It will make sure, that only items related to the filters are displayed.

    You can also experiment with these options and combinations, to get the best possible configuration to your needs.

    3. I tried the “read” keyword on both instances, but I am seeing results right now. It might have been only a temporary server or connection issue, it should be fine now.
